    well I got 4 more 3D figures from my friend postman Davie,


    one is of the goddess Bastet,the other a female knight with a cat,and two other cats, 9_9


    with this lot I,m going to try and get a smoother finish to them by using acetone, :$


    there is 3 ways I did see looking into this one the hot vapor,the cold vapor or the dunk, ¬¬ o.O


    think I will try the hot vapor as it dose seam to be the fastest of them,and more fun heating acetone in a jar on a stove or heat mat ,oh what fun,


    just must remember not to have a smoke,lol, :S


    so have to get a biggish jar to do this in so will be going down the shops later anyway,


    and my idea is to look after what detail there is on the face but undercoating them,and this way it should seal ,from the vapor I do hope, :/

              well,I,m very happy with the result of the hot vapor,way of smoothing the layers of ,a 3d print,


              and to me gives a very smooth and shiny finish on them,


              all in all about 10mins in the glass jar,untill I,could see there starting to work,so another 3 / 5 mins and took them out,


              so will leave sit and harden again,I did hear on the youtube,it can take up till 2 days,


              the under coat did help,as it keep them ,for over doing on fine detail,but will still lose some of it,but I can live with that, :/


              and a little bit of the lines hear and there,so over all I,m very happy,would like another go on the first again,


              as you can real see the difference with the two,you may think why i did do her boobs well with ones like that lol,did not wont to lose the shape of them, 9_9
